Herbal medicine courses can help you learn about plant-based remedies, dosage forms, preparation techniques, and the therapeutic properties of various herbs. You can build skills in identifying medicinal plants, formulating herbal products, and understanding the interactions between herbs and pharmaceuticals. Many courses introduce tools like herbal databases, extraction equipment, and formulation software, that support creating effective herbal treatments and ensuring safety in their application.
